Soraon
Assembly constituency 255 (SC) · Uttar Pradesh · 73 candidatures, 2002–2022

[05]Every candidature
| Year | Pos | Candidate | Party | Votes | Vote % |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2022 | 1 | Geeta Shastri (Pasi)WON | Samajwadi Party | 91,474 | 41.3% |
| 2022 | 2 | Dr. Jamuna Prasad Saroj | Apna Dal (Soneylal) | 85,884 | 38.8% |
| 2022 | 3 | Anand Bharti | Bahujan Samaj Party | 29,250 | 13.2% |
| 2022 | 4 | Sita Ram | All India Majlis-E-Ittehadul Muslimeen | 5,128 | 2.3% |
| 2022 | 5 | Manoj Kumar Pasi | Indian National Congress | 2,027 | 0.9% |
| 2022 | 6 | Anil Kumar Gautam | Aazad Samaj Party (Kanshi Ram) | 1,622 | 0.7% |
| 2022 | 7 | Sudhir Kumar | Jansatta Dal Loktantrik | 1,189 | 0.5% |
| 2022 | 8 | Rakesh Kumar Gautam | Independent | 1,108 | 0.5% |
| 2022 | 9 | Pradeep Kumar Jatav | Ambedkarite Party Of India | 1,056 | 0.5% |
| 2022 | 10 | Lallan | Aam Aadmi Party | 1,014 | 0.5% |
| 2022 | 11 | Ratnesh Kumar Chaudhari | Pragatisheel Samaj Party | 955 | 0.4% |
| 2022 | 12 | Rakesh Kumar | Lok Samaj Party | 750 | 0.3% |
| 2017 | 1 | Jamuna PrasadWON | Apna Dal (Soneylal) | 77,814 | 36.6% |
| 2017 | 2 | Geeta Devi | Bahujan Samaj Party | 60,079 | 28.3% |
| 2017 | 3 | Satyaveer | Samajwadi Party | 54,345 | 25.6% |
| 2017 | 4 | Surendra Kumar | Bharatiya Janata Party | 6,522 | 3.1% |
| 2017 | 5 | Ajay Kumar | Independent | 2,907 | 1.4% |
| 2017 | 6 | Krishan Kumar | Bhartiya Rashtriya Jansatta | 1,285 | 0.6% |
| 2017 | 7 | Manoj | Rashtriya Samaj Paksha | 1,208 | 0.6% |
| 2017 | 8 | Sunil Kumar Rajpasi | Bharat Kranti Rakshak Party | 1,095 | 0.5% |
| 2017 | 9 | Ashok Kumar | Independent | 976 | 0.5% |
| 2017 | 10 | Phool Chandra | Communist Party of India (Marxist) | 932 | 0.4% |
| 2017 | 11 | Javahar Lal Divakar | Indian National Congress | 847 | 0.4% |
| 2017 | 12 | Shyam Lal | Bahujan Awam Party | 771 | 0.4% |
| 2017 | 13 | Munna | Pragatisheel Samaj Party | 738 | 0.4% |
| 2017 | 14 | Lilawati | Yuva Vikas Party | 700 | 0.3% |
| 2012 | 1 | Satyaveer MunnaWON | Samajwadi Party | 61,153 | 32.9% |
| 2012 | 2 | Babu Lal #bhawara# | Bahujan Samaj Party | 47,852 | 25.7% |
| 2012 | 3 | Vachaspati | Independent | 28,073 | 15.1% |
| 2012 | 4 | Ajay Kumar Pasi | Indian National Congress | 22,039 | 11.9% |
| 2012 | 5 | Nirmla Paswan | Bharatiya Janata Party | 6,123 | 3.3% |
| 2012 | 6 | Geeta Devi | Apna Dal | 3,075 | 1.7% |
| 2012 | 7 | Khushiram | Mahan Dal | 2,819 | 1.5% |
| 2012 | 8 | Bharat Lal | Independent | 2,379 | 1.3% |
| 2012 | 9 | Lallan | Nationalist Congress Party | 2,026 | 1.1% |
| 2012 | 10 | Ashok Kumar Saroj | Janata Dal (United) | 1,796 | 1.0% |
| 2012 | 11 | Santosh Kumar | Independent | 1,390 | 0.7% |
| 2012 | 12 | Pratiyush Kumar (Chamar) | Independent | 1,335 | 0.7% |
| 2012 | 13 | Surendra Chaudhary | Rashtriya Lokmanch | 1,091 | 0.6% |
| 2012 | 14 | Munna | Independent | 938 | 0.5% |
| 2012 | 15 | Vidyawati | Rashtriya Swabhimaan Party | 876 | 0.5% |
| 2012 | 16 | Dinesh Chandra Sonkar | Independent | 839 | 0.5% |
| 2012 | 17 | Lock Bahadur Gond (Durya) | Independent | 702 | 0.4% |
| 2012 | 18 | Rambrij Gautam | Rashtriya Janwadi Party (Krantikari) | 498 | 0.3% |
| 2012 | 19 | Rajkumar | Yuva Vikas Party | 485 | 0.3% |
| 2012 | 20 | Govind Kumar | Independent | 480 | 0.3% |
| 2007 | 1 | Rakesh Dhar TripathiWON | Bahujan Samaj Party | 62,151 | 41.5% |
| 2007 | 2 | Mahesh Narayan Singh | Samajwadi Party | 60,809 | 40.6% |
| 2007 | 3 | Manoj Kumar Alias Lala Mishra | Pragtisheel Manav Samaj Party | 8,704 | 5.8% |
| 2007 | 4 | Veni Madhav Bind | Bharatiya Janata Party | 3,989 | 2.7% |
| 2007 | 5 | Shyama Charan | Independent | 3,482 | 2.3% |
| 2007 | 6 | Krishna Raj Singh | Indian National Congress | 2,391 | 1.6% |
| 2007 | 7 | Rani Devi | Independent | 1,698 | 1.1% |
| 2007 | 8 | Arvind Kumar | Independent | 1,553 | 1.0% |
| 2007 | 9 | Dhani Lal | Rashtriya Lok Dal | 1,369 | 0.9% |
| 2007 | 10 | Lal Chandra | Independent | 1,097 | 0.7% |
| 2007 | 11 | Gyan Prakash Alias G P Yadav | Jan Morcha | 778 | 0.5% |
| 2007 | 12 | Raj Kumar | Indian Justice Party | 672 | 0.5% |
| 2007 | 13 | Jai Prakash Bhartiya | Rashtriya Swabhimaan Party | 602 | 0.4% |
| 2007 | 14 | Ram Niranjan | Muslim Majlis Uttar Pradesh | 512 | 0.3% |
| 2002 | 1 | Mahesh Narain SinghWON | Samajwadi Party | 73,074 | 45.9% |
| 2002 | 2 | Rakesh Dhar Tripathi | Bharatiya Janata Party | 45,759 | 28.8% |
| 2002 | 3 | Brij Bhan Yadav | Bahujan Samaj Party | 24,596 | 15.5% |
| 2002 | 4 | Phool Chand Bind | Apna Dal | 4,288 | 2.7% |
| 2002 | 5 | Narendra Kumar | Independent | 2,953 | 1.9% |
| 2002 | 6 | Tribhuwan Pratap | Independent | 2,408 | 1.5% |
| 2002 | 7 | Vidya Devi | Pragtisheel Manav Samaj Party | 2,152 | 1.4% |
| 2002 | 8 | Bal Ram Bind | Indian National Congress | 1,844 | 1.2% |
| 2002 | 9 | Tej Bahadur | Independent | 586 | 0.4% |
| 2002 | 10 | Mahesh Chand | Independent | 533 | 0.3% |
| 2002 | 11 | Jitendra Bahadur | Independent | 333 | 0.2% |
| 2002 | 12 | Shyam Bihari | Rashtriya Kranti Party | 325 | 0.2% |
| 2002 | 13 | Jiya Lal | Independent | 274 | 0.2% |
